如何利用AI语音人工智能实现智能语音助手?

随着人工智能技术的不断发展,AI语音助手已经成为了我们日常生活中不可或缺的一部分。如何利用AI语音人工智能实现智能语音助手,成为了众多企业和开发者关注的焦点。本文将从以下几个方面详细介绍如何实现智能语音助手。

一、AI语音助手的基本原理

AI语音助手是基于人工智能技术,通过语音识别、自然语言处理、语音合成等技术,实现人机交互的一种智能服务。其基本原理如下:

  1. 语音识别:将用户的语音信号转换为文本信息,理解用户的需求。

  2. 自然语言处理:对用户输入的文本信息进行分析,提取关键信息,理解用户的意图。

  3. 语音合成:根据用户的需求,生成相应的语音输出。

  4. 知识库:存储大量的信息,为AI语音助手提供知识支持。

二、实现智能语音助手的步骤

  1. 选择合适的语音识别技术

语音识别是AI语音助手的核心技术之一。目前,市场上主流的语音识别技术有基于深度学习的端到端语音识别、基于声学模型和语言模型的混合语音识别等。在选择语音识别技术时,需要考虑以下因素:

(1)识别准确率:准确率越高,用户体验越好。

(2)实时性:实时性越高,用户等待时间越短。

(3)适用场景:根据实际应用场景选择合适的语音识别技术。


  1. 自然语言处理技术

自然语言处理技术是实现AI语音助手智能的关键。主要包括以下技术:

(1)分词:将用户输入的文本信息分解成词语。

(2)词性标注:对词语进行分类,如名词、动词、形容词等。

(3)句法分析:分析句子的结构,理解句子的含义。

(4)语义理解:根据上下文理解用户的意图。


  1. 语音合成技术

语音合成技术是将文本信息转换为语音输出的过程。目前,市场上主流的语音合成技术有基于规则的方法、基于参数的方法和基于深度学习的方法。在选择语音合成技术时,需要考虑以下因素:

(1)音质:音质越高,用户体验越好。

(2)发音速度:发音速度适中,既不过快也不过慢。

(3)情感表达:能够根据文本内容表达相应的情感。


  1. 知识库建设

知识库是AI语音助手提供知识支持的基础。主要包括以下内容:

(1)通用知识:如地理、历史、科学等领域的知识。

(2)行业知识:针对特定行业的知识。

(3)企业知识:企业内部的知识,如产品信息、业务流程等。


  1. 用户界面设计

用户界面设计是用户与AI语音助手交互的界面。主要包括以下内容:

(1)语音输入:提供语音输入功能,方便用户进行语音交互。

(2)文本输入:提供文本输入功能,方便用户进行文本交互。

(3)可视化界面:通过图形、图像等方式展示信息,提高用户体验。


  1. 测试与优化

在实现AI语音助手的过程中,需要进行充分的测试与优化。主要包括以下内容:

(1)功能测试:测试AI语音助手的各项功能是否正常。

(2)性能测试:测试AI语音助手的响应速度、准确率等性能指标。

(3)用户体验测试:邀请用户进行实际使用,收集用户反馈,不断优化AI语音助手。

三、AI语音助手的应用场景

  1. 智能家居:通过AI语音助手控制家电设备,如空调、电视、灯光等。

  2. 智能客服:为用户提供24小时在线客服,解答用户疑问。

  3. 智能驾驶:辅助驾驶员进行驾驶,如导航、语音控制等。

  4. 智能教育:提供个性化学习方案,辅助学生学习。

  5. 智能医疗:为患者提供健康咨询、预约挂号等服务。

总之,利用AI语音人工智能实现智能语音助手,需要从多个方面进行技术研究和应用。通过不断优化和完善,AI语音助手将为我们的生活带来更多便利。

猜你喜欢:北京医疗器械翻译